Editorial: A Sick Set of Laws
The Howard Government's inexorable push to strip workers' rights continues; despite the warnings of unions, churches, community groups, labour market economists and now, epidemiologists.

That's right - after much debate about how the changes will affect the Australian way of life; concerns have now been raised that they will be a threat to Australian life itself.

Drawing on the field of social epidemiology - that is the study of how social conditions affect public health - ACIRRT has painted a picture of a society where the gap between the life expectancy of the rich andthe poor will widen.
